备注:知识点标签Git上打标签标签的管理参考备注:本文参考于廖雪峰老师的博客Git教程。依照其博客进行学习和记录,感谢其无私分享,也欢迎各位查看原文。知识点git tag 新建一个标签,默认表示的是HEAD,当前提交.git tag v0.9 commit_id在指定提交上创建标签git tag -a -m "blablabla..."指定标签信息;git tag -s -m "blablabla
在开发过程中,使用 SVN(Subversion) 进行版本管理是常见的。然而面对需求变更、代码回滚等问题时,我们可能会遇到“Android SVN 删除提交记录”的情况。本文将详细记录解决该问题的步骤,包括备份策略、恢复流程、灾难场景、工具链集成、案例分析及迁移方案,确保代码安全和高效管理。 ### 备份策略 进行任何操作之前,备份是必不可少的。这可以防止数据丢失,且便于恢复。以下是备份的流
原创 7月前
65阅读
SVN基础操作 SVN下载地址:客户端:TortoiseSVN: http://tortoisesvn.net/downloads.html服务器端:VisualSVN: http://www.visualsvn.com/server/download 1.      安装服务器端,打开服务器端,创建仓库和新建用户。
一、基本SVN操作  安装了SVN之后,在本机上点击右键,就能够看到如下信息:  1、建立SVN Repository  下面来建立一个SVN Repository。这个文件夹是同步用的,你可以放在本机的任意目录,也可以放在公司的服务器上面。  建立SVN Repository的步骤如下:  任意选择一个空目录 =》 右键 =》 选择TortoiseSV
转载 2024-06-28 06:08:49
209阅读
SVN的一些操作记录,仅供参考SVN常见操作删除已经commit的文件/文件夹修改文件/文件夹名称SVN merge操作 SVN常见操作版本管理是编程的必备技能之一,楼主在上学的时候基本没有接触过版本管理的软件(毕竟半路出家…)。在公司开始接触SVN/Git之后也遇到了一些问题,经常因为不够熟悉,导致浪费很多不必要的时间,因此在这里记录一下SVN的一些常用操作,仅供参考!删除已经commit的文件
记录一下工作中常用到的svn命令一、文件的提交流程1.svn up   // 先更新本地文件2.svn st   // svn status 查看要提交的文件3.#svn ci -m "xxx" filename  // 提交提交的文件 //加 # 号,是为了防止在输入命令时,不小心按错,直接提交,写好命令后,去掉 # 号 //注意:为确保文件的
转载 2023-10-17 11:44:36
570阅读
1、查看Git提交记录# git log2、找到需要回滚到的提交点,复制它的hash值# git reset --hard 你复制的hash值3、将当前指向的head推到git# git push --force ...
原创 2021-11-13 15:22:58
1529阅读
1、查看Git提交记录# git log2、找到需要回滚到的提交点,复制它的hash值# git reset --hard 你复制的hash值3、将当前指向的head推到git# git push --force ...
原创 2022-01-16 13:39:30
1110阅读
这种方式是最快最有效的 进项目根目录启动git bash,然后执行这些即可 最后的 git push -f origin master 会失败,直接在idea里push就能成功了
原创 2022-08-18 12:25:16
187阅读
回退git版本
原创 2023-07-07 15:21:08
1940阅读
1点赞
1.增加(Add)先提到变更列表中,再commit到配置库中,选择新增文件,右键SVN菜单执行“Add“操作提交到”变更列表中”,然后右键SVN菜单执行”SVNCommit”提交到版本库中。2.删除(Delete)如果被删除的文件还未入版本库,则可以直接使用操作系统的删除操作删除该文件。如果被删除的文件已入版本库,则删除的方法如下:选择被删除文件,右键svn菜单执行”delete”操作,然后选择被
1.首先找到本次提交后生成的版本号,例如为r224. 2.登录到svn服务器上,进入到项目的svn目录. 3.进入db目录,删除此目录下的rep-cache.db。并修改此目录下的current文件,将其修改为上一个版本,例如233. 4.删除db/revs/0/目录下的224文件。 5.删除db/revprops/0/目录下的224文件。
转载 2024-05-03 06:39:03
2910阅读
git reset --hard HEAD^git push --force
原创 2022-10-28 16:30:17
126阅读
一、vscode使用 SVN1、在vscode插件中心搜索svn 进行安装(我这里已经安装完毕了) 注意:插件安装成功,需要重新启动软件。安装成功后会出现如下的图标:2、桌面右键使用SVN Checkout… 来检出远程库的代码,完事使用vscode打开项目 这里红色感叹号表示:项目本地有改动与远程库不一样,蓝色对勾表示:代码和远程是同步的没有改动。3、对代码进行修改,并查看具体有哪里文件 Cha
SVN 查看历史信息 通过svn命令可以根据时间或修订号去除过去的版本,或者某一版本所做的具体的修改。以下四个命令可以用来查看svn历史svn log 用来展示svn 的版本作者、日期、路径等等 svn diff 用来显示特定修改的行级详细信息 svn cat 取得在特定版本的某文件显示在当前屏幕 svn list 显示一个目录或某一版本存在SVN 查看历史信息 通过svn命令可以根据时间
转载 2023-06-19 14:58:37
470阅读
前言领导让我将以前一个工程的文档给维护的同事。 我只是那个项目的参与者,不是作者。要文档我哪有啊…, 只好尝试将svn提交日志导出给他。 领导以前从来没要求研发向svn提交时写提交日志,也没有要求写changlog和其他设计文档,这时候问我有没有文档,整的有点懵逼。 还好我提交日志的习惯还蛮好的,每次提交都会写提交的原因文本。上网找了一下,已经有同学做了实验。 我也记录一下。实验在svn目录中建立
转载 2024-01-04 18:04:33
160阅读
查看历史提交记录 git-bash git log 如果觉得比较凌乱,可以用简略版:git log --pretty=oneline ...
转载 2021-09-09 10:28:00
443阅读
2评论
# Python获取SVN提交记录的指南 在软件开发中,版本控制是非常重要的。SVN(Subversion)是一种常用的版本控制系统,能够帮助开发者管理代码的版本。如果你是刚入行的小白,下面将为你详细介绍如何使用Python获取SVN提交记录。 ## 流程概览 在实现获取SVN提交记录的功能前,我们可以将整个过程分为以下几个步骤: | 步骤 | 说明 | |------|------|
原创 2024-10-24 03:48:24
180阅读
最近支援其他项目组,之前代码一直是git托管,这边是svn就学习了一下,这边记录一下。 首先Windows的cmd是不能直接运行svn指令的。需要安装Apache Subversion command line tools (下载地址:https://www.visualsvn.com/downloads/ ),解压后把里面bin目录路径添加到环境变量的path,这样在cmd下就可以使用了。che
转载 2024-07-15 08:24:46
148阅读
# Java 获取 SVN 提交记录的完整指南 在开发过程中,使用 SVN(Subversion)来管理代码和版本是非常常见的。对于刚刚入行的小白,如何在 Java 中获取 SVN提交记录可能会让人感到困惑。本文将为你提供一个简洁的流程和详细的步骤,帮助你实现这个目标。 ## 整体流程 在开始之前,我们可以先了解获取 SVN 提交记录的整体流程。下面是一个简单的步骤表格: | 步骤 |
原创 11月前
143阅读
  • 1
  • 2
  • 3
  • 4
  • 5